  3. 29 minutes ago, Vanessa8580 said:

    Too many people in that car ! 

    And the approach of the dune was wrong ....

    Agree. Approach should either be straight up or a wider angle for criss-crossing - he was in-between. Also no momentum, so no chance to steer down on the other side and use gravity to recover.  Driver seems very inexperienced with insufficient following distance. With no seatbelts they were lucky that only Pajero was dented. Also no off-road flags to be seen anywhere - something that I have unfortunately observed quite a few times lately.

  6. Eric, you should read the grading of off-road members for this group. You are a newbie for at least 5 Newbie drives, after which you can be promoted to Fewbie (and join those drives) subject to your skills with your vehicle. To be honest, I had a CRV before and I would not even do a Newbie drive with that in the desert (doing a circle on flat sand is not what we do on out drives!) - not real 4x4. But Gaurav is very skilled in guiding different types of cars and maybe he will assess you on the Absolute Newbie drive. For sure you should not venture on Fewbie drive at this stage. Just my 5c.
